Effectiveness and Termination of Agreement. This Agreement shall become effective upon the execution and delivery of this Agreement by the parties hereto. This Agreement may be terminated at any time prior to the Time of Purchase by the Representatives if, prior to such time, any of the following events shall have occurred: (i) trading in the Company’s securities shall have been suspended by the Commission or the New York Stock Exchange (“NYSE”) or trading in securities generally on the NYSE shall have been suspended or limited or minimum prices shall have been established on such exchange; (ii) a banking moratorium shall have been declared either by U.S. federal or New York State authorities; (iii) any material disruption of securities settlement or clearance services; or (iv) any outbreak or escalation of hostilities, declaration by the United States of a national emergency or war or other calamity, crisis or disruption in financial markets, the effect of which on the financial markets of the United States is such as to impair, in the judgment of the Representatives, the marketability of the Securities. If the Representatives elect to terminate this Agreement, as provided in this Section 9, the Representatives will promptly notify the Company and each other Underwriter by telephone or facsimile, confirmed by letter. If this Agreement shall not be carried out by any Underwriter for any reason permitted hereunder, or if the sale of the Securities to the Underwriters as herein contemplated shall not be carried out because the Company is not able to comply with the terms hereof, the Company shall not be under any obligation under this Agreement except as provided in Section 4(l) hereof and shall not be liable to any Underwriter or to any member of any selling group for the loss of anticipated profits from the transactions contemplated by this Agreement and the Underwriters shall be under no liability to the Company nor be under any liability under this Agreement to one another.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the provisions of Section 4(j) hereof, Section 4(k) hereof, Section 4(l) hereof, Section 7 hereof and Section 8 hereof shall survive termination of this Agreement.
